If you are too nice, you will just get eaten alive. The football world is not always a nice place.
Zlatan Ibrahimovic
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Being overly nice can lead to being taken advantage of in a competitive environment.

This quote by Zlatan Ibrahimovic highlights the harsh realities of competitive situations, suggesting that excessive kindness can lead one to be exploited or overlooked. In environments such as sports, where aggression and assertiveness often dictate success, being overly accommodating may render an individual vulnerable to being overshadowed or disregarded.
